發表文章

目前顯示的是 8月, 2014的文章

NoSQL

http://blog.toright.com/posts/3809/mongodb-%E6%95%99%E5%AD%B8-linux-%E5%AE%89%E8%A3%9D-nosql-mongodb.html

RESTful

http://blog.toright.com/posts/1399/%E6%B7%BA%E8%AB%87-rest-%E8%BB%9F%E9%AB%94%E6%9E%B6%E6%A7%8B%E9%A2%A8%E6%A0%BC-part-ii-%E5%A6%82%E4%BD%95%E8%A8%AD%E8%A8%88-restful-web-service.html

JDBC出現unhandled exception type IllegalAccessException

狀況: 執行Class.forName(driverName).newInstance(); eclipse出現error訊息:unhandled exception type IllegalAccessException 原因: Class.forName("com.mysql.jdbc.Driver").newInstance(); 這行程式需要exception操作,要做try catch或throws, 而在jsp中,eclipse對於採用<% %>方式寫的程式碼不做異常檢查,因為JSP預設會做try catch。 解決方法:         try{             Class.forName(driverName).newInstance();         }         catch(Exception e){             //for catch Class.forName exception         }

Eclipse預設編碼設定UTF-8

Eclipse預設編碼設定UTF-8 workspace:Window->Preferences->General->Workspace->Text file encoding html:Window->Preferences->Web->HTML files->encoding css:Window->Preferences->Web->CSS files->encoding jsp:Window->Preferences->Web->JSP files->encoding Show line numers:Window->Preferences->General->Editors->Text Editors Reference http://www.ewdna.com/2011/09/eclipse.html

Java Servlet MVC web app

Servlet http://www.javatutorialscorner.com/2014/04/servlet-hello-world-sevlet-using.html https://blogs.oracle.com/swchan/entry/servlet_3_0_annotations http://pro.ctlok.com/2010/02/mvc-servlet-jsp.html http://openhome.cc/Gossip/ServletJSP/FirstServlet.html http://www.codedata.com.tw/java/java-tutorial-the-3rd-class-3-servlet-jsp/ http://pro.ctlok.com/2010/02/java-ee-6-glassfish-v3-mysql-51-ejb-jpa.html http://lawpronotes.blogspot.tw/2010/01/java-ee-6-servlet-30-annotations.html http://www.dotblogs.com.tw/alantsai/Tags/servlet/default.aspx http://openhome.cc/Gossip/ServletJSP/DispatchRequest.html startup啟動 How to Run Java Program Automatically on Tomcat Startup http://crunchify.com/how-to-run-java-program-automatically-on-tomcat-startup/ 週期自動執行 Background Thread for a Tomcat servlet app http://stackoverflow.com/questions/791986/background-thread-for-a-tomcat-servlet-app How to run a background task in a servlet based web application? http://stackoverflow.com

tcpdump設定執行時間

tcpdump & sleep 1m ; killall tcpdump /path/to/tcpdumpbinary --whatever-args-you-need & sleep 10s && pkill -HUP -f /path/to /tcpdumpbinary reference http://phorum.vbird.org/viewtopic.php?f=2&t=32773 http://www.linuxquestions.org/questions/linux-wireless-networking-41/how-to-limit-the-tcpdump-command-to-a-time-interval-945468/

Linux tcpdump

Linux使用tcpdump命令抓包保存pcap文件wireshark分析  http://liuzhigong.blog.163.com/blog/static/1782723752012851043396/ tcpdump 的用法 http://blog.xuite.net/jyoutw/xtech/23669726 Linux tcpdump命令详解 http://www.cnblogs.com/ggjucheng/archive/2012/01/14/2322659.html

[轉貼]Linux下推薦的常用應用程序列表

Linux下推薦的常用應用程序列表 一,網頁瀏覽 1,firefox firefox是現在最火的一個瀏覽器,支持好多擴展和插件,也有很多漂亮的主題.firefox就是mozilla-firefox,他是把mozilla的網頁瀏覽的功能分離為一個單獨的瀏覽器.Firefox一般是linux系統自帶的默認瀏覽器. 2,opera(非開源免費軟體) opera是號稱最快的瀏覽器.能直接瀏覽wap網站,並且在瀏覽器集成了irc聊天,電子郵件,新聞組,RSS的簡單功能.並且能改變使瀏覽器識別為IE或mozilla. 3,mozilla mozilla的前身是netscape,知道一點計算機的歷史的人都知道這個瀏覽器.集網頁瀏覽,新聞組,網頁設計,電子郵件等於一體的瀏覽器.被捆綁在windows操作系統裡面的IE擠垮之後,現在為開放源代碼的軟體. 4,dillo 這個是我見過的最小的,最快的瀏覽器.有最基本的網頁瀏覽的功能.有的網頁效果不支持.但速度絕對是一流的快.默認不支持中文,可以下載已經打過中文補丁的版本. 5,w3m w3m是一個基於文本的瀏覽器,能在控制台下使用.支持中文.在某些時候能應急用一下.安裝 插件之後支持圖片. 二,聯絡聊天 1,lumaqq 在linux下面兼容QQ的客戶端.是用sun JAVA編寫的,啟動的時候有點慢.支持自定義表情,手機簡訊顯示等級,QQ群等.並且能使用QQ網路硬碟 2,Gaim 一個多功能的聊天工具.支持幾乎所有的聊天協議.如icq,msn,jabber等.安裝openq插件后支持QQ. 3,Xchat 一個irc聊天工具.irc是什麼?玩windows可以不知道irc,但玩linux必須知道.irc是一個聊天工具.在中國還不是太流行.(黑客都是用這個交流的哦!) 4,eva 一個KDE環境的的QQ客戶端,有文件傳輸,屏幕抓圖等功能. 三,Email客戶端 1,evolution GNOME默認的郵件客戶端.支持pop3,imap4,smtp等協議.有聯繫人,郵件,日曆,任務,等功能,如果你有很多辦公事務要處理,這個軟體和適合你. 2,thunderbird 像firefox一樣,從mozilla分離出來的郵件客戶端.在windows,linux等下都有相當大的用戶群. 3,kmail KDE桌面套件的一部分. 4,mutt mutt

移除JRE6,安裝JRE7 on Debian

沒有先移除jre6,即使安裝jre7也不會自動改為預設的JVM 移除jre6 apt-get autoremove openjdk-6-jre-lib (自動安裝jre7) 安裝jdk7 apt-get install openjdk-7-jdk 手動設定預設JVM: https://www.digitalocean.com/community/tutorials/how-to-manually-install-oracle-java-on-a-debian-or-ubuntu-vps

debian不能make編譯

問題: 在debian執行 make指令, 但回應bash: make: command not found 解決方式: 安裝build-essential command: apt-get install build-essential reference http://www.cyberciti.biz/faq/debian-linux-install-gnu-gcc-compiler/